Cummins Inc. (CMI), a leading global manufacturer of heavy-duty engines, power generation systems and decarbonization solutions, is trading at $631.22 as of 2026-04-20, posting a 0.64% gain on the day. Recent market analysis coverage of CMI has focused on its range-bound trading activity and exposure to high-growth decarbonization markets, aligning with investor focus on the stock’s technical and fundamental drivers.
